What happens when you stop chasing a career and start following a calling? In Episode 66 of The Industrious Podcast, cohosts Vince Todd, Jr. and Joe Todd sit down with Corrie Leister, owner of Inspired By U — a company dedicated to transforming homes through professional painting, staining, and renovation services.
But Corrie's story goes far beyond beautiful finishes. She shares how she built not just a thriving business, but a community — launching Inspired By U University to bring finishing experts together, fostering collaboration and shared growth across the industry.

If you’ve ever enjoyed the shrimp cocktail at St. Elmo Steak House in Indianapolis, you can thank the family behind Huse Culinary. For the evolution of their family business and out-of-state growth on the horizon, tune in to episode 50 of The Industrious Podcast with Craig Huse.

In episode 42 of The Industrious Podcast, co-hosts Joe and Vince Todd, Jr. are joined by Milind and Sunjay Agtey of Nimbello, an accounts payable automation platform. From career shakeups to business risks, don’t miss this conversation on the benefits of betting on yourself.

In episode 26 of The Industrious Podcast, co-hosts Joe and Vince Todd, Jr. are joined by Bill Kennedy and Jim Kennedy, President and Vice President of Sales of Kennedy Tank & Manufacturing Company. Tune in as Bill and Jim share their entry into a fifth generation family business and the top principles they follow to care for their company and employees.

In episode 21 of The Industrious Podcast, Accessa’s Vince Todd, Jr., and Kevin Fine are joined by Lindsey Boyle, Sales & Marketing Specialist for Belco Industries. In this episode, Lindsey shares her journey from a high school history teacher to learning the trade of her family’s finishing and aluminum extrusion company. In episode 20 of The Industrious Podcast, co-hosts Joe and Vince Todd, Jr. are joined by Chris Hendricks, President/CEO of Duncan Supply Company, Inc. Tune in as Chris shares his evolution in joining a fourth generation family business, as well as supply chain and employee constraints in the pandemic era.
